Игровая разработка претерпевает революцию! Flash ActionScript 3 уступает!
VK Mini Apps стали полем битвы за внимание пользователей, и тут HTML5 с
Phaser.js выходит на передовую, особенно в жанре бродилок, где важна скорость!
Flash ActionScript 3: Наследие и современные перспективы
ActionScript 3 – это мощный инструмент, но его время уходит. 🕰️
Однако, AS3 не стоит списывать со счетов! Для старых проектов и
энтузиастов он остается актуальным. 🎮 Flash все еще жив благодаря
VK Mini Apps, где можно вдохнуть жизнь в старые проекты! Новое дыхание
Flash и ActionScript 3 в VK – это неожиданный, но реальный союз! ✨
Сравнение Flash и HTML5 для разработки игр: Ключевые различия и преимущества
Сражение титанов! Flash vs HTML5: что лучше для твоей игры в VK Mini Apps?
Производительность и оптимизация: ActionScript 3 против JavaScript (Phaser.js)
Влияет ли технология на FPS в VK Mini Apps? 🤔 AS3 был шустрым, но как
JavaScript с Phaser.js? Оптимизация – вот ключ к плавной игре! 🔑
AS3 требует меньше ресурсов, но HTML5 гибок. JavaScript может
быть быстрее благодаря современным движкам, но требует оптимизации
кода. Важно учитывать особенности VK Mini Apps и адаптировать код! ⚙️
Кроссплатформенность: Доступность игр на различных устройствах через HTML5
HTML5 – король кроссплатформенности! 👑 Твоя игра будет работать везде,
где есть браузер, включая мобильные устройства. Больше игроков – больше
возможностей для монетизации в VK Mini Apps! 💰 С HTML5 и Phaser.js
твоя бродилка станет доступна на любом устройстве без установки!
Не нужны отдельные версии для Android и iOS! Просто, удобно, выгодно! 👍
Интеграция с VK Mini Apps API: Сравнение подходов
Как подружить игру с VK Mini Apps? 🤔 API – это мост между твоей
игрой и платформой VK. Flash требует обходных путей, а HTML5 и
JavaScript интегрируются напрямую! VK Mini Apps API позволяет
реализовать авторизацию, хранение данных и социальные функции. 🤝
HTML5 дает больше гибкости в использовании VK Bridge для взаимодействия.
Переход с Flash на HTML5: Руководство и лучшие практики
Миграция неизбежна! Как безболезненно перевести игру с Flash на HTML5?
Миграция кода: Перенос логики и ресурсов из ActionScript 3 в JavaScript
Переезд – это всегда стресс! 🤯 Но перенос кода из AS3 в JavaScript
может быть проще, чем кажется. Разберите код на модули, перепишите
логику на JavaScript и используйте Phaser.js для управления графикой. 🖼️
Перенос ресурсов – тоже важный шаг. Оптимизируйте изображения и
звуки для HTML5! Используйте инструменты для автоматизации процесса.
Использование Phaser.js для разработки 2D-игр: Преимущества и примеры
Phaser.js – твой лучший друг при переходе на HTML5! 🌟 Это мощный
игровой движок, который упрощает создание 2D-игр. Он бесплатен и
имеет открытый исходный код. 👍 Phaser.js предлагает множество
функций: управление спрайтами, анимация, физика, работа со звуком и
многое другое! Смотри примеры игр на Phaser.js и вдохновляйся! 🚀
Оптимизация HTML5 игр для VK Mini Apps: Советы и рекомендации
Медленная игра – потерянные игроки! 🐌 Оптимизация – залог успеха в VK
Mini Apps. Уменьшайте размер изображений, используйте спрайт-листы,
оптимизируйте код JavaScript. Кэшируйте ресурсы, чтобы игра быстрее
загружалась. ⚡️ Тестируйте игру на разных устройствах, чтобы убедиться,
что она работает плавно. Используйте инструменты профилирования кода.
Разработка бродилок на HTML5 с использованием Phaser.js: Пошаговый пример
Создаем хит! Пошаговая инструкция по разработке бродилки на HTML5 и Phaser.js.
Создание базовой структуры игры: Сцены, спрайты, анимация
С чего начать разработку бродилки? 🤔 С создания базовой структуры!
Сцены – это отдельные уровни или экраны в игре. Спрайты – это
графические объекты, которые двигаются и взаимодействуют друг с
другом. Анимация – это последовательность изображений, которая
создает иллюзию движения. Phaser.js упрощает работу со сценами,.
Реализация механики движения и взаимодействия персонажа
Как заставить персонажа двигаться и взаимодействовать с миром? 🤔
Реализуйте механику движения: ходьба, прыжки, бег. 🏃♀️ Обрабатывайте
нажатия клавиш или касания экрана. Добавьте взаимодействие с
объектами: сбор предметов, активация механизмов, борьба с врагами. ⚔️
Используйте физический движок Phaser.js для реалистичной физики!
Интеграция с VK Mini Apps API: Авторизация, хранение данных, социальные функции
Подключаем игру к VK! 🤝 Авторизация позволяет идентифицировать
игрока. Хранение данных сохраняет прогресс игры. Социальные функции
позволяют делиться достижениями с друзьями. Используйте VK Mini
Apps API для реализации этих функций. VK Bridge обеспечивает
бесшовную интеграцию с платформой VK. Получайте данные пользователя.
Монетизация игр в VK Mini Apps: VK Pay и In-App Purchases
Зарабатываем на игре! VK Pay и In-App Purchases – способы монетизации твоей бродилки.
Настройка VK Pay для приема платежей в игре
VK Pay – удобный способ приема платежей! 💰 Подключите VK Pay к своей
игре, чтобы игроки могли легко покупать виртуальные товары и услуги.
Интегрируйте VK Pay API в свой код. Создайте кнопку “Купить” и
обрабатывайте платежи. VK Pay обеспечивает безопасные и быстрые
транзакции. Используйте VK Pay для монетизации своей бродилки!
Реализация In-App Purchases: Продажа виртуальных товаров и услуг
In-App Purchases – ключ к постоянному доходу! 🔑 Предлагайте игрокам
виртуальные товары и услуги: бонусы, улучшения, скины, уровни.
Создайте каталог товаров и интегрируйте его в игру. 🛒 Используйте VK
Pay или другие платежные системы для обработки покупок. Анализируйте,
что покупают игроки, и предлагайте им новые товары и услуги! 📈
Примеры успешной монетизации игр в VK Mini Apps
Учимся у лучших! 🏆 Изучите примеры успешных игр в VK Mini Apps,
которые зарабатывают на VK Pay и In-App Purchases. Какие товары
и услуги они продают? Как они привлекают игроков к покупкам?
Анализируйте их стратегии и применяйте их в своей игре. Вдохновляйтесь
успехом других разработчиков и создавайте свою прибыльную игру! 💰
ActionScript 3 оптимизация для игр
Даже старый код можно ускорить! 🔥 Оптимизация ActionScript 3 – это
способ вдохнуть новую жизнь в ваши Flash-игры для VK Mini Apps.
Используйте эффективные алгоритмы, избегайте лишних вычислений,
оптимизируйте графику и звук. Профилируйте код, чтобы найти узкие
места и устранить их. AS3 еще может показать класс, если его.
Что ждет нас впереди? HTML5 и VK Mini Apps – будущее игровой разработки?
HTML5 и Phaser.js как перспективная альтернатива Flash
HTML5 и Phaser.js – это мощный тандем! 🤝 Они предлагают
кроссплатформенность, гибкость и простоту разработки. HTML5
поддерживается всеми современными браузерами, а Phaser.js
упрощает создание 2D-игр. Это отличная альтернатива Flash для
разработчиков, которые хотят создавать игры для VK Mini Apps! 🚀
Развитие VK Mini Apps как платформы для игровых разработчиков
VK Mini Apps – это перспективная платформа! 🌟 Она предлагает
большую аудиторию, удобные инструменты разработки и возможности
монетизации. VK Mini Apps развивается и становится все более
привлекательной для игровых разработчиков. Присоединяйтесь к
сообществу разработчиков VK Mini Apps и создавайте свои хиты! 🔥
Коллекция полезных ресурсов и инструментов для разработки игр в VK Mini Apps
Собираем все необходимое! 🛠️ Вот коллекция полезных ресурсов и
инструментов для разработки игр в VK Mini Apps: документация VK
Mini Apps API, Phaser.js, графические редакторы, звуковые редакторы,
инструменты профилирования кода. Используйте эти ресурсы, чтобы
упростить разработку и создать качественную игру! Успехов вам! 🎉
Таблица (в html формате)
Сравним характеристики Flash и HTML5 (Phaser.js) для разработки игр:
Характеристика | Flash (ActionScript 3) | HTML5 (Phaser.js) |
---|---|---|
Кроссплатформенность | Ограниченная (требуется Flash Player) | Высокая (поддерживается всеми современными браузерами) |
Производительность | Высокая (при правильной оптимизации) | Высокая (зависит от оптимизации и устройства) |
Интеграция с VK Mini Apps API | Требуются обходные пути | Прямая интеграция через JavaScript и VK Bridge |
Монетизация | VK Pay, In-App Purchases (требуется интеграция) | VK Pay, In-App Purchases (прямая интеграция через API) |
Поддержка и развитие | Ограниченная (Flash устаревает) | Активная (HTML5 развивается, Phaser.js поддерживается) |
Простота разработки | Зависит от опыта разработчика | Phaser.js упрощает разработку 2D-игр |
Эта таблица поможет вам сделать осознанный выбор при разработке игр!
Сравнительная таблица (в html формате)
Рассмотрим сравнительные характеристики движков для разработки бродилок:
Функциональность | Action Script 3 (Flash) | Phaser.js (HTML5) |
---|---|---|
Поддержка графики | Векторная и растровая | Растровая (WebGL) |
Физика | Встроенная | Arcade Physics, Matter.js |
Анимация | Timeline, ActionScript | Sprite sheets, Tweens |
Аудио | Поддержка различных форматов | Web Audio API |
Работа с сетью | XML, Sockets | AJAX, WebSockets |
IDE | Adobe Flash Builder | Любой текстовый редактор |
Эта таблица даст представление о возможностях движков при разработке!
Отвечаем на самые частые вопросы о разработке игр для VK Mini Apps:
- Вопрос: Стоит ли сейчас начинать разработку на ActionScript 3?
Ответ: ActionScript 3 подходит для поддержки старых проектов. Для
новых разработок лучше использовать HTML5 и Phaser.js. - Вопрос: Сложно ли перейти с ActionScript 3 на JavaScript?
Ответ: Переход потребует времени и усилий, но Phaser.js упрощает
процесс разработки на HTML5. - Вопрос: Как монетизировать игру в VK Mini Apps?
Ответ: Используйте VK Pay и In-App Purchases для продажи
виртуальных товаров и услуг. - Вопрос: Где найти ресурсы для обучения Phaser.js?
Ответ: На сайте Phaser.io, в документации, на форумах и в
видеоуроках. - Вопрос: Как оптимизировать HTML5 игру для VK Mini Apps?
Ответ: Уменьшайте размер ресурсов, используйте спрайт-листы и
кэширование.
Надеемся, эти ответы помогут вам в разработке успешной игры!
Таблица (в html формате)
Оценим примерные затраты ресурсов для разработки игры (бродилки):
Ресурс | Flash (ActionScript 3) | HTML5 (Phaser.js) | Примечания |
---|---|---|---|
Время разработки | Среднее | Среднее | Зависит от опыта |
Стоимость инструментов | Высокая (Adobe Flash) | Низкая (бесплатные редакторы) | Альтернативы есть |
Необходимые навыки | ActionScript 3 | JavaScript, HTML, CSS | Современные языки |
Сообщество | Уменьшается | Растущее | Поддержка важна |
Оптимизация | Важна | Важна | Влияет на производительность |
Учитывайте ресурсы при выборе технологии разработки для VK Mini Apps!
Сравнительная таблица (в html формате)
Сравним API для работы с платежами в играх VK Mini Apps:
Функция | VK Pay API | In-App Purchases API | Описание |
---|---|---|---|
Прием платежей | Прямой | Через платформу VK | Разные способы интеграции |
Продажа товаров | Поддерживается | Поддерживается | Виртуальные товары и услуги |
Безопасность | Высокая | Высокая | Защита транзакций |
Интеграция | Требуется настройка | Через VK Mini Apps | Сложность интеграции |
Документация | Доступна | Доступна | Необходима для работы |
Выбирайте API для монетизации, исходя из ваших потребностей!
FAQ
Отвечаем на часто задаваемые вопросы по оптимизации ActionScript 3:
- Вопрос: Какие инструменты использовать для профилирования AS3 кода?
Ответ: Adobe Scout, Flash Builder Profiler.
- Вопрос: Как уменьшить время загрузки Flash-игры?
Ответ: Оптимизируйте ресурсы, используйте сжатие, загружайте по
частям. - Вопрос: Как оптимизировать графику в AS3?
Ответ: Используйте векторную графику, уменьшайте количество
объектов. - Вопрос: Как оптимизировать код AS3?
Ответ: Избегайте лишних циклов, используйте эффективные
алгоритмы. - Вопрос: Как оптимизировать звук в AS3?
Ответ: Используйте сжатые форматы, уменьшайте частоту
дискретизации.
Применяйте эти советы для улучшения производительности ваших игр!